Position Overview 

The Assistant Project Manager position serves as a vital step transitioning from a production-focused role to a more project management-oriented position. This role involves leading project teams, overseeing the design and production of civil engineering documents, and coordinating with subconsultants. The Assistant Project Manager is responsible for mentoring junior staff, managing resources, assisting with permitting, and maintaining project schedules. Additionally, this role begins to emphasize client interaction and business development, laying the 

foundation for building relationships and securing new or repeat work. 

Key Responsibilities

  • Assist in leading a multidisciplinary production team, managing resources effectively to meet project goals. Address technical and design challenges, providing timely solutions to ensure project continuity and quality
  • Coach, train, and mentor design and CAD professionals, fostering an environment of continuous learning and skill development. Promote best practices and encourage collaboration
  • Work collaboratively with all team members on various aspects of project execution, ensuring clear communication, alignment, and efficiency throughout all project stages
  • Oversee the design and production of comprehensive civil engineering construction documents, including site plans, utility plan/profiles, stormwater management facility CDs, design reports, and technical specifications
  • Lead and contribute to the design of civil utilities and site layouts, including water supply, sanitary sewer systems, storm drainage, hydraulic grade line (HGL) modeling, fire flow designs, grading plans, sediment and erosion control measures, and stormwater management systems
  • Coordinate with subconsultants such as geotechnical engineers, architects, and environmental specialists to ensure seamless integration of all project components
  • Assist in coordinating with review agencies for site permitting, facilitating communication, and addressing agency feedback to maintain compliance and timelines
  • Ensure that all project work aligns with McAdams’ standards from the conceptual phase through construction administration, contributing to high-quality outcomes across various types of projects
  • Schedule projects strategically to align with permitting timelines, optimize internal resource allocation, and ensure timely and viable deliverables for clients
  • Maintain a focus on delivering high-quality results that meet client expectations and project requirements, balancing timelines and quality assurance throughout the project lifecycle
  • Begin to cultivate a business development-oriented approach by building and nurturing professional relationships with clients, subconsultants, and industry partners.
  • Perform other duties as assigned

Skills + Experience 

  • Four-year bachelor’s degree from an accredited program in Civil Engineering, Environmental Engineering, Biological and Agricultural Engineering, Civil Engineering Technology, or related field required
  • EI required; PE or on track to obtaining PE strongly preferred
  • Minimum of 5+ years’ experience in civil site design or related field required
  • Proficiency in Civil 3D, AutoCAD, and relevant engineering design software. Strong understanding of site design, utility layouts, and stormwater management
  • Ability to manage resources, schedule projects, and oversee multiple tasks simultaneously.
  • Excellent communication, leadership, and problem-solving abilities. Ability to mentor and guide team members effectively
  • Demonstrated ability to build and maintain client relationships with a focus on service quality and business development
